✨ Desire stays abstract and weak when it lives as a vague wish.

✨ You want something, but nothing moves because the intention is not clear enough to act on. Without definition, measurement, or a deadline, desire stays aspirational. It feels real in thought, but it has no shape in practice.

✨ Stop treating desire like passive wishing.

✨ Turn it into a clear commitment with numbers and a timeline. The moment it becomes specific and measurable, it stops being a feeling and starts becoming something you can move toward.

✨ The intensity of intention rises when desire is made concrete.

✨ When you define it, quantify it, and attach it to a deadline, it becomes actionable. What was once abstract now has direction, which makes action easier and more natural.

... Read moreFrom my own experience, I can attest that setting specific, measurable, and time-bound goals turns vague wishes into powerful motivators. When I first tried goal-setting, my desires felt distant and unattainable because I lacked clarity. However, once I started defining exactly what I wanted—for example, reading 12 books in 3 months or saving a set amount of money by a certain date—I noticed a major shift. The desire became tangible, creating a sense of urgency that encouraged daily action. Additionally, deadlines help overcome procrastination by making the desire less abstract and more urgent. The clear parameters not only organize efforts but also provide milestones to celebrate, which fuels motivation further. Over time, this approach built my self-discipline and improved my mindset, empowering me to tackle challenges head-on instead of remaining stuck in wishful thinking. Remember, without definition and deadlines, desire often remains a passive thought. By committing to measurable goals and a deadline, you transform feelings into concrete steps.
